CVE-2026-68478 1 Linux 1 Linux Kernel 2026-08-18 5.5 Medium
In the Linux kernel, the following vulnerability has been resolved: memstick: ms_block: reject a card that reports too many blocks msb_ftl_initialize() computes the zone count from the card block count with no bound: msb->zone_count = msb->block_count / MS_BLOCKS_IN_ZONE; ... for (i = 0; i < msb->zone_count; i++) msb->free_block_count[i] = MS_BLOCKS_IN_ZONE; msb->block_count is a card value. msb_read_boot_blocks() reads number_of_blocks from the card boot page and byte swaps it. free_block_count is a fixed int[MS_MAX_ZONES]. MS_MAX_ZONES is 16, so the valid indices are 0 to 15. The init loop above indexes it by zone_count. msb_mark_block_used() and msb_mark_block_unused() index it by pba / MS_BLOCKS_IN_ZONE, for pba up to block_count - 1. A card may report up to 65535 blocks. A block_count above 8192 (MS_MAX_ZONES * MS_BLOCKS_IN_ZONE) lets the pba index reach 16. That writes past free_block_count[] and corrupts struct msb_data. A larger count runs the init loop past the end too. A real Memory Stick has at most 16 zones. So it has at most 8192 blocks. msb_ftl_initialize() now rejects a card that reports more than MS_MAX_ZONES * MS_BLOCKS_IN_ZONE blocks.
CVE-2026-72098 1 Linux 1 Linux Kernel 2026-08-18 9.8 Critical
In the Linux kernel, the following vulnerability has been resolved: dm-verity: fix buffer overflow in FEC calculation There's a buffer overflow in dm-verity-fec: if (neras && *neras <= v->fec->roots) fio->erasures[(*neras)++] = i; This allows *neras to reach roots + 1 (the post-increment pushes it past roots). This value is then passed as no_eras to decode_rs8(). Inside the RS decoder (lib/reed_solomon/decode_rs.c:113-121), the erasure locator polynomial loop writes lambda[j] where j can reach nroots + 1 — one element past the end of lambda[] (which is sized nroots + 1, valid indices 0..nroots). The out-of-bounds write lands on syn[0], corrupting the syndrome buffer.

CVE-2026-68474 1 Linux 1 Linux Kernel 2026-08-18 7.8 High
In the Linux kernel, the following vulnerability has been resolved: powerpc/spufs: fix out-of-bounds access in spufs_mem_mmap_access() spufs_mem_mmap_access() computes the local store offset as address - vma->vm_start, but bounds-checks it against vma->vm_end instead of the local store size. On 64-bit, offset is always well below vma->vm_end, so the clamp never fires and len stays unbounded against the LS_SIZE buffer returned by ctx->ops->get_ls(). Reject offsets at or beyond LS_SIZE and clamp len to the remaining space, mirroring the guard already used by spufs_mem_mmap_fault() and spufs_ps_fault().

CVE-2026-73193 1 Perl5-dbi 1 Dbi 2026-08-18 9.8 Critical
DBI versions before 1.652 for Perl allow a heap out-of-bounds write on 32-bit perl via an integer wraparound in the output buffer size computed by preparse. preparse reserves its output buffer with `newSV(strlen(statement) * 7 + 16)`, budgeting seven output bytes per input byte for the longest ':p99999' expansion. The product is computed in STRLEN, which is 32 bits wide on a 32-bit perl build, so a statement of 613,566,757 bytes multiplies to 4,294,967,299, wraps modulo 2^32 to 3, and reserves 19 bytes. The parser then copies the statement out through a raw pointer with no capacity check, writing the whole 585 MB input past the end of the allocation. The 99,999 placeholder limit does not bound this path, which is reached by ordinary non-placeholder content. Any caller that passes an untrusted statement of that length to preparse on a 32-bit perl gets a heap out-of-bounds write of attacker controlled bytes. Builds with a 64-bit STRLEN are not affected, since the wrap there needs a statement of about 2.3 exabytes.

CVE-2026-73194 1 Perl5-dbi 1 Dbi 2026-08-18 9.1 Critical
DBI versions before 1.652 for Perl allow a heap out-of-bounds write via an unvalidated numeric placeholder that sets the binder counter in preparse. preparse reserves seven output bytes per input byte, the width of the longest ':p99999' expansion. The ':N' branch parses the number with `atoi(src)` and assigns it to the binder counter with no range check, so a statement containing ':2147483648' leaves the counter negative (-2147483648 with glibc, where atoi wraps). Each following '?' then expands through `sprintf(start, ":p%d", idx++)` to ':p-2147483648', 14 bytes with the terminating NUL where the buffer budgets 7. The placeholder limit added in 1.650 tests the counter against 99,999, which a negative counter passes. Any caller that preparses an untrusted statement into ':pN' style placeholders gets a heap out-of-bounds write that grows with the number of '?' marks following the poisoned placeholder. The '?' and '%s' return styles compare the parsed number against the expected sequence and error out, and are unaffected.
